Standards for Materials Databases: ASTM Committee E49

Abstract: To prevent duplication of effort and to facilitate the building of compatible databases on material property data, ASTM Committee E49 on Computerization of Material Property Data has active efforts underway to develop standards and guidelines in the areas of: (1) designation systems for engineering materials, (2) recording formats for test results and other property data, (3) formats for the exchange of data between materials databases and for data entry purposes, (4) indicators of data quality, and (5) harmon… Show more

“…Serious efforts to address standards for materials data, particularly structural materials data, were undertaken as long as 30 years ago [35]. In 1985, ASTM International established Committee E49 on Computerization of Material Property Data to develop standard guidelines and practices for materials databases [36]. ASTM International devoted quite substantial effort over a decade and issued data standards relevant to materials through the 1990s, specifically addressing key issues such as how to describe materials, how to record data, data quality indicators, harmonization of terminology, and guidelines for building and distributing databases.…”

“…Prior efforts at the creation and maintenance of large scale materials databases, such as the efforts of ASTM Committee E-49 for the Computerization of Materials Property Data [5] and the National Materials Property Data Network [6] (which was operated commercially from the mid 1980's until 1995), were largely focused on chemical composition, average properties and effective material response. A shortcoming of these efforts, largely due to the limited computing power of the times, was that details of the materials internal structure or microstructure was not considered and captured alongside the composition and properties.…”
